Первый же вопрос, который мне задали после выхода статьи «Релиз WordPress 3.0 — Thelonious» — а сколько же памяти потребляет это чудо? Действительно, предыдущие замеры касались английской версии wordpress 3.0 RC1, а сейчас наконец-то появилась возможность замерить потребление памяти у русской версии.Для этого на локалхосте (UniServer) я разместил два дистрибутива wordpress 3.0 — английский и русский, скачанные с официального сайта. В папку plugins помимо стандартно имеющихся там Akismet и Hello Dolly, были загружены также WP-Memory-Usage 1.1.0 и WP-Tuner 0.9.6. Активирован только WP-Memory-Usage. Никаких других изменений не проводилось.
Вот что показали замеры:
Английская версия WordPress 3.0:
Последняя из 2-ой ветки, английская версия wordpress 2.9.2 в этой конфигурации потребляет 13,66 МБ.
Русская версия WordPress 3.0 прожорливее:
Для сравнения: русский wordpress 2.9.2 в этой же конфигурации «кушает» 17, 14 МБ.
Далее начались приколы... Попытка активировать WP-Tuner привела к белому экрану на обоих дистрибутивах. Вернуть всё в норму получилось только после удаления папки wp-tuner из plugins. Так что будьте внимательны — не все плагины пока работают с wordpress 3.0 — ждём обновлений.
Мультисайтовость пока не включал — еще надо разобраться как это делается ))) Появятся новые результаты — обязательно сделаю отчёт.
upd. Внимание! Данные в статье существенно обновлены — замеры на UniServer оказались жутко неточными, пришлось заново всё тестить на Wampserver 2.0i — перепроверял несколько раз — эти результаты стабильны. Огромное спасибо Михаилу, автору блога «С кодом по жизни» за поддержку мыслями и цифрами.
Какие у вас впечатления от WordPress 3.0?
Афигеть!!! какая разница! мне ооочень интересно с чего так! У меня тока одна мысль в голове! это итог корявых рук того кто русифицировал!?!?!?
Очень интересные цифры. Вызвано видать это тем, что в русской версии подключаются файлы руссификации, в отличии от английской.
Суть в том, что локализованные версии для перевода постоянно обращаются к файлам локализации, английская версия — нет. Вот из этого и получается такое потребление оперативки...
А жестко прописать русский язык в коде нельзя — руссификация будет постоянно слетать при обновлении...
А если не ставить обновления, можно работать наверно и на 3 версии не один год. Уж больно велика разница перед русифицированой
По идее, если вам понятно, как использовать админку на английском, то можно ставить английскую версию, и русифицированный в коде шаблон. Экономия оперативной памяти будет значительная...
Приблизительно этот же метод использовал и Lecactus в своих дистрибутивах wordpress.
Хотя, если подумать, то даже такой расход оперативки не смертелен. Мой хостер, например, предоставляет мне 128МБ. Плюс при большой посещаемости включаем кеширование.
Млин, так ждал я выхода этой версии, а тут приходиться еще и немного обламаться, обидно. Если у меня сейчас 2.9.2 потребляет 40.27 Mbyte? то сколько интересно 3-я версия будет кушать, я немного в шоке, если честно...
Кстати — да, надо бы еще в эксперимент включить и русскую версию 2.9.2. — тогда будет понятнее — обновляться или нет...
А я как всегда с опаской отношусь ко всем этим обновлениям. Не привык я к ним. Наверно я заядлый консерватор.
Надо конечно подождать до версии 3.0.1 или типа того — счаз вспылвет куча багов — когда их поправят тогда и можно ставить будет
Сколько?! в 18 разя тяжелее?! Нет, я конечно в этом деле новичек... И великий и могучий мне дорог)) Но чего-то много.
И действительно... если сравнивать 2.9.2 и 3.0 английские — какой больше памяти надо?
Офигеть! Это ж как перевести нужно, чтоб русская версия потяжелела так?
А вот меня пугает другое: смотри — ты в блоге пишешь тематичные посты, а я набор букв, слегка связанных смыслом. Мне впаяли 10ку тИЦа, а тебе нет.
Почему Яша считает, что мой блог полезнее?
ОченьЗлой, а вот почему мой блог по запросу «dofollow» в Гугле на 3 месте, а в Яше на 200счемтотам? Ответ один: а ХЗ
Ответ один разные алгоритмы поиска и ранжирования страниц, подсчета их веса и т.д. Да и вообще Яшу в последнее время колбасит не по детски со всеми алгоритмами.
Откуда 2mb взялось в минимальной конфигурации??
Английская версия WordPress потребляет 16Mb минимум.
WP-Memory-Usage: 15.98 of 256 MByte
TPC-Memory-Usage: 16.1M/256M
PHP Version: 5.2.6
Zend Engine: 2.2.0
Русская соотвественно:
Memory : 19.78 of 256 MByte
Memory Usage: 20.07M/256M
+3Mb. При старте в 16 — не очень то и много.
Михаил, спасибо, что подтвердили мои сомнения. Буквально вчера вечером провёл небольшой эксперимент — поставил на локалхост (Uniserver)точную копию своего блога. По идее, потребление памяти должно быть приблизительно одинаковым, а в результате uniserver показал потребление 14,95МВ , а у хостера 25,15 МВ. Количество запросов одинаковое. Сегодня утром включаю локалхост — 3,47МВ на той же странице...
Похоже, сервер ввёл в заблуждение меня, а я — читателей...
Сейчас буду ставить wampserver 2.0 и смотреть, что он покажет...
Помогите разобраться.
Э... Могут быть нюансы
Я использовал xampp под Виндой. И это цифры потребления из админки.
Возможно для одной страницы и будет 3.47Mb.
(Честно я был бы только рад если бы хватало 3 метров для всего :), но к сожалению WordPress невероятно прожирлив.)
Внимание! Данные тестов потребления памяти существенно обновлены!
Прошу прощения у всех, кто заблуждался вместе со мной
Михаил, напишите мне на мыло — с меня постовой
А какой у тебя хостер? Хороший обьем дает.
Провинциальный Манимейкер, смотри здесь s-hosting.biz/page_1.html
Рекламировать не буду, но и менять хостера пока не собираюсь...
Это VPS
localhost называется.
Михаил,понятно, что замеры на локалхосте сделаны, но и мой хостер тоже дает memory limit 256мб, чему я сам был удивлён. Во всяком случае, так показывают и memory-usage и server-info. И это не VPS, потому что какой может быть VPS за 2.50$ в месяц?
Николай, так имя хостера в студию
И план желательно :).
256Mb за 30$/год вполне неплохо — что они еще предлагают?
Михаил, ссылка в комменте #21, мой тариф s-300.
Ну а дальше вы уж сами) Ато и так что-то много у меня бесплатной рекламы
С их службой поддержки еще не сталкивался — ничего сказать не могу. Иногда сайт лежит вместе со всеми и страничкой хостера, но не больше чем пару часов. Вобщем смотрите- появятся какие-либо замечания- поделитесь- интересно — к осени хочу брать тариф побольше, но пока сомневаюсь...
Хостеры образца 99 года, в тарифах и планах ни слова о:
— ограничениях на размер базы mysql
— сколько серверов в среднем на одном shared сервере.
— о трафике и ширине канала (unlimited traffic при ширине канала в 2Mb уже выглядит unlimited
)
А как по мне, в любом случае стоит пользоваться локализованной версией. А еще лучше — подождать обновления версии перевода и убивания багов, чем заниматься этим самому.
Пока не обновлялась еще. Но все ближе к этому уже.
Я вот думаю старые сайты не обновлять, а вот новый сдл на нем сделать, потестил 3.0 на денвере, вроде ничетак)) Кстати спасибо за плагин WP-Memory-Usage, давно подобный искал.
Я на 2.9.2.
Не уверен, обновляться или нет!!!
Igor, протестируйте сначала на локалхосте — еще не все плагины работают под WP 3.0
WordPress 3 слишком прожорливый, стоял еще 2.8.4 или 2.8.6 потреблял 5.5 — 7.5 мегабайт на страницу, поставил третий потребление выросло до 16.5 — 17.5 на страницу, пришлось пока от обновления отказаться и откатить все назад.
Комментирование закрыто.
17:13
Может я чего не понял — английская версия получается почти в 18 раз легче что ли? Если так, то английская версия рулит мля ))
А в сравнении с 2.9.2 какая легче получается не вкурсе?